Description

Situated in the thriving harbour town of Amble with many shops, cafes and restaurants along with Amble Harbour Village with retails pods, Little Shore Beach and Pier, a centrally located and neatly presented first floor two bedroom maisonette which is well proportioned with generous accommodation throughout. Benefitting from double glazing and electric heating, there is also plenty of storage including a hallway with an understairs area useful for bikes etc. Briefly comprising to the ground floor: entrance door to lobby and entrance hall, stairs to the half landing with fitted kitchen off and from the main landing a spacious lounge, two bedrooms and a bathroom. Outside, the flat is accessed through a gated shared courtyard from the rear lane. Amble is a town growing in popularity with shopping and leisure amenities and a local bus service to Morpeth, Alnwick and to the towns and villages beyond. The train station in Alnmouth provides a regular service to Edinburgh, Newcastle with connections throughout the country. The A1 is close to hand with its motorway links to the north and south of the county and the coastal road offers convenient and quick journey times to Ashington, Cramlington and to roadway links to the Tyne Tunnel.
